小学生三年级编程学什么
-
小学三年级的编程学习主要包括以下内容:
-
程序设计基础:学习基本的编程概念和术语,如算法、变量、循环和条件语句等。通过简单的编程任务和练习,让学生了解编程的基本原理和逻辑思维。
-
图形化编程语言:为了让小学生更好地理解和掌握编程,通常会使用图形化编程语言,如Scratch、Blockly等。这些语言使用图形化的拖拽式界面,让学生通过拖拽和组合不同的图形块来编写程序。
-
创意编程:编程不仅是为了解决问题,还可以用来创造和表达想法。在三年级的编程学习中,学生将被鼓励使用编程来创造有趣的动画、游戏和故事等。这有助于培养学生的创造力和想象力。
-
协作与团队合作:编程学习也强调学生之间的协作和团队合作能力。学生会有机会参与编程项目,与同学一起合作解决问题,分享和交流自己的编程作品。
-
基本的算法思维:在编程学习中,学生需要学会分析问题、制定解决方案,并将其转化为可执行的算法。这有助于培养学生的逻辑思维和问题解决能力。
通过以上内容的学习,小学三年级的学生可以初步掌握编程的基本概念和技能,培养逻辑思维和创造力,并为进一步的编程学习奠定基础。编程不仅可以帮助学生提高解决问题的能力,还可以培养学生的创新精神和团队合作能力,为他们未来的学习和工作打下坚实的基础。
1年前 -
-
小学三年级的学生在编程方面主要学习以下内容:
-
算法和逻辑思维:编程教育的基础是培养学生的逻辑思维能力。学生需要学习如何分析问题,设计解决方案,并将其转化为编程代码。他们将学习如何使用控制结构(如循环和条件语句)来控制程序的流程。
-
图形编程:为了吸引小学生的兴趣,通常会使用图形化编程环境来教授编程。这样的环境通常提供了可视化的编程块,学生只需将这些块拖放到正确的位置即可创建程序。这种方式可以帮助学生更好地理解编程概念。
-
编程概念和语法:小学三年级的学生会学习一些基本的编程概念,如变量、函数、循环和条件语句。他们将学习如何使用这些概念来解决简单的问题。此外,学生还会学习一种编程语言,如Scratch或Blockly,用于实践这些概念。
-
创意编程:编程教育不仅仅是为了教授技术能力,还可以培养学生的创造力和创新思维。在小学三年级,学生可以开始使用编程来创作动画、游戏和故事等有趣的项目。这样的活动可以激发学生的想象力和创造力。
-
协作与解决问题:编程教育也注重培养学生的协作和问题解决能力。学生通常会在小组中进行编程项目,他们需要学会与他人合作,分享想法,并共同解决问题。这样的经验可以帮助学生发展团队合作和沟通技巧。
综上所述,小学三年级的编程教育主要包括算法和逻辑思维、图形编程、编程概念和语法、创意编程以及协作与问题解决能力的培养。这些教育内容旨在通过培养学生的逻辑思维、创造力和协作能力,为他们未来的学习和职业发展打下坚实的基础。
1年前 -
-
在小学三年级阶段,学生可以开始学习一些基础的编程知识和概念。以下是一些建议的编程学习内容和方法。
一、学习Scratch编程语言
Scratch是一个适合小学生学习编程的图形化编程语言。它通过拖拽积木块的方式,让学生能够轻松地创建自己的交互式故事、游戏和动画。学习Scratch可以帮助学生培养逻辑思维和问题解决能力。学习方法:
- 下载并安装Scratch软件。Scratch软件是免费的,可以在官网上下载。
- 学习Scratch的基础知识,包括如何创建角色、添加背景、使用积木块编写程序等。
- 制定学习计划,每天或每周学习一些新的Scratch编程知识,并通过实践项目来巩固所学内容。
- 参加Scratch编程社区或学习班,与其他学生一起分享和学习。
二、学习计算机基础知识
除了学习具体的编程语言,小学三年级的学生还可以学习一些计算机基础知识,包括计算机硬件、操作系统、网络等。学习方法:
- 学习计算机的基本组成和工作原理,了解计算机的硬件结构和各个组件的功能。
- 学习操作系统的基本知识,如Windows、Mac OS等,了解如何使用计算机操作系统进行文件管理和基本的软件使用。
- 学习网络基础知识,包括网络的概念、互联网的组成、常见的网络协议等。
三、参加编程俱乐部或培训班
除了自学,学生还可以参加一些编程俱乐部或培训班,通过与其他学生一起学习和交流,提高编程技能。参加编程俱乐部或培训班的好处:
- 与其他学生一起学习,可以相互鼓励和交流,提高学习效果。
- 有专业的老师指导,可以及时解答问题和指导学习。
- 可以参加一些编程比赛和活动,锻炼编程能力。
总结:
小学三年级的学生可以通过学习Scratch编程语言和计算机基础知识,来培养他们的逻辑思维、问题解决能力和创造力。同时,参加编程俱乐部或培训班可以提供更好的学习环境和机会。重要的是,要保持学习的兴趣和坚持不懈,编程是一项需要长期学习和实践的技能。1年前